How the Car Insurance Online Calculator Works
The calculator uses risk-based pricing models similar to those used by insurance companies. It evaluates different personal and vehicle-related factors to estimate the likelihood of claims and accident costs.
Basic pricing concept:
Insurance Premium = Base Rate × Risk Factors + Coverage Cost − Discounts
Key factors included:
- Vehicle make, model, and age
- Driver age and experience
- Driving history (accidents or violations)
- Location risk level
- Annual mileage
- Coverage type (basic, comprehensive, full coverage)
- Deductible amount
- Credit score (in some regions)
Higher risk factors lead to higher premiums, while safe drivers and low-risk vehicles receive lower rates.

Key Factors That Affect Insurance Cost
Driver Profile
Young or inexperienced drivers usually pay higher premiums.
Vehicle Type
Luxury and sports cars cost more to insure.
Location
Urban areas have higher risk and higher premiums.
Driving History
Clean driving record leads to lower costs.
Coverage Level
More coverage means higher insurance premiums.
Types of Car Insurance Coverage
Liability Insurance
Covers damage to other people and property.
Collision Coverage
Covers damage to your own vehicle in accidents.
Comprehensive Coverage
Covers theft, fire, and non-collision damage.
Full Coverage
Combination of liability, collision, and comprehensive protection.

Common Mistakes to Avoid
Only Looking at Price
Cheap insurance may offer limited protection.
Ignoring Deductible Impact
High deductible reduces premium but increases risk.
Not Updating Information
Changes in driving history affect rates.
Choosing Wrong Coverage Type
Insufficient coverage can lead to financial loss.
Additional Insights
Car insurance pricing is based on statistical risk modeling. Even small changes in your profile, such as moving to a new location or adding a new driver, can affect your premium.
Online calculators help users understand how insurance companies evaluate risk, making it easier to choose the right policy without confusion.
